Have you ever changed the valve cover gasket? If your low on oil AND a plug all of a sudden is misfiring, maybe oil is seeping into that plug space, and normally a valve cover kit would come with new o-ring that go around the ignition tubes. Just check for oil residue when you take the coil pack off and pull the tube out.

Had similar issues w the touring.
Had a vacuum leak - dunno where, will find out.
Changed out fuel filter
Changed O2 bank 2 sensor 2 - code thrown before
Indy mechanic also thought this was bad gas. When is the last time you filled up and where? He recommended dry gas, but no one really sells it since the ethanol content is so high and dry gas is essentially alcohol. NAPA auto sold me an ethanol gas treatment enzyme deal. Star Brite Star Tron in funky blue bottle. Guy there claimed it works. I added about 2 ounces to my tank and had no further issues (immediately following vacuum line repair tho).
